In this note, using Feynman path integual method we calculate the Casimir effct of QCD with massive fermion loop contribution between two parallel perfectly conducting wires at zero temperture.

The boundary S matrix for the SU(2) Thicking model is derived and the boundary state is constructed with the bosonic field.

Nounal bands of the Well deformed odd A nuclei are studied with the cranking Bohr-Mottelson Hamiltonian. The condition of validity of the model and comparison with the Harris expansion are discussed.

The flavor-changing raciative B decays and flavo-conserving radiative decays of groundstate mesons are studied with another screened potential model. The results are compared with the counterparts of the comell potential and El hassan's work.

A folding model for the 16O+12C system is established.This model can well describe the elastic scattering between 16O and 12C nuclei.
